How much do vice president sap erp implementation j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 12, 2026, the average yearly pay for vice president sap erp implementation in the United States is $162,439.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$130,000.00 and $194,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a vice president SAP ERP implementation, and why are they important?

To excel as a Vice President of SAP ERP Implementation, you need deep expertise in SAP solutions, project management experience, and a strong background in business process optimization, typically backed by a relevant degree and prior leadership in large-scale ERP deployments. Familiarity with SAP modules (such as S/4HANA), implementation methodologies (like ASAP or Activate), and certifications such as SAP Certified Application Associate are highly valued. Outstanding leadership, strategic thinking, and communication skills set top performers apart as they align cross-functional teams and manage complex stakeholder expectations. These skills are crucial for ensuring successful project delivery, minimizing risk, and driving transformative business outcomes.

What does a vice president SAP ERP implementation do?

A Vice President of SAP ERP Implementation oversees the planning, execution, and management of SAP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) system deployments within an organization. This executive leads cross-functional teams, ensures that implementation aligns with business goals, manages budgets and timelines, and addresses potential risks. They work closely with stakeholders to customize SAP solutions for optimal efficiency and integration, and are responsible for the overall success of the ERP initiative.

What is the difference between Vice President Sap Erp Implementation vs SAP Project Manager?

AspectVice President Sap Erp ImplementationSAP Project Manager
ResponsibilitiesOversees entire SAP ERP implementation strategy, manages multiple teams, and aligns projects with business goals.Manages specific SAP projects, coordinates teams, and ensures project deliverables meet deadlines and budgets.
Required CredentialsTypically requires extensive SAP certifications, leadership experience, and a bachelor's or master's degree in related fields.Requires SAP certifications, project management credentials (e.g., PMP), and relevant experience.
Work EnvironmentExecutive-level, strategic planning, and cross-departmental collaboration.Project-focused, team coordination, and technical problem-solving.

The Vice President Sap Erp Implementation holds a higher strategic and leadership role, overseeing multiple projects and aligning SAP initiatives with business objectives. In contrast, the SAP Project Manager focuses on executing specific projects, managing teams, and ensuring project success within scope and time constraints.

What are the main challenges a vice president SAP ERP implementation typically faces during large-scale rollouts?

A Vice President of SAP ERP Implementation often encounters challenges such as aligning cross-functional teams on objectives, managing change resistance among stakeholders, and ensuring seamless integration with existing systems. Balancing project timelines and budgets while maintaining system quality and user adoption is crucial. Effective communication, strong leadership, and proactive risk management are essential for overcoming these obstacles and ensuring a successful implementation.
